This rating is based on a measure of “ideological alignment” from an academic study - Bakshy, Messing, and Adamic (2015). This measure averages the self-reported ideology (where -2 is very liberal and 2 is very conservative) of users who shared an article from this source on a major social media website. “Alignment” is not a measure of media slant; rather, it captures differences in the kind of content shared among a set of partisans, which can include topic matter, framing, and slant.

Bakshy E., Messing S., Adamic L. (2015). Exposure to ideologically diverse news and opinion on Facebook. Science, 348, 1130–1132. doi:10.1126/science.aaa1160
